| Error | Cause | Solution |
|-------|-------|----------|
| Communication error | Printer not in Service Mode | Repeat the button sequence carefully |
| Timeout | USB driver issue | Reinstall Epson driver, try another USB port |
| Counter reset failed | Wrong program version | Find version 2.1.0 or higher for L3060 |
| Antivirus deleted the file | False positive | Disable real-time protection temporarily |
| Printer still shows error | Pad counter not only issue | Check if waste ink pad is physically full |

If you own an Epson L3060 printer, you may eventually encounter the dreaded "Service Required" error or alternating red lights. This is a common issue related to the ink pad counter. The solution often involves an Adjustment Program. This guide covers what the program does, the risks of downloading it for free, and how to use it safely.
